ImmuniWeb SA is a global application security company headquartered in Geneva, Switzerland. The company is profitable, cashflow positive and rapidly growing since its incorporation in 2019. The award-winning ImmuniWeb® AI Platform helps over 1,000 customers from more than 50 countries to discover, test and protect their web and mobile applications, APIs and micro services, cloud and network infrastructure, and third-party systems processing corporate data.

ImmuniWeb will participate in the upcoming webinar “5 Stories Around AI” by the British Computer Society (BCS), which takes place on May 23, 2025, from 8:00 PM to 9:30 PM CEST.
The event will bring together leading voices from the global tech community to explore the evolving role and implications of artificial intelligence across various industries. The agenda includes five expert-led presentations, each focusing on a unique challenge and opportunity presented by AI.
Dr. Ilia Kolochenko, Chief Architect & CEO at ImmuniWeb, will deliver a presentation entitled “Practical Implications of GenAI in Cybersecurity and Cybercrime.” His session will examine how generative AI is being weaponized by cybercriminals and what strategies organizations can adopt to mitigate new types of threats.
This insights-driven webinar is designed for IT leaders, cybersecurity professionals, and decision-makers looking to stay ahead of the curve in AI-related risk and innovation.
